The Monday night football game between the Buffalo Bills and Cincinnati Bengals was suspended after an NFL star suffered unexpected cardiac arrest.
Buffalo Bills safety Damar Hamlin suffered a hit before collapsing on the field. He was given CPR for over 10 minutes and received oxygen as he was taken off the field and put into an ambulance.
During the first quarter of the game, Hamlin had been injured following a tackle on Cincinnati Bengals receiver Tee Higgins. Hamlin was seen quickly getting up after the tackle before unexpectedly collapsing on the field.

After being taken off the field, the remaining Bills remained on the sidelines of the field while both head coaches met with referees. Ultimately, it was decided that the game would be paused until further notice.
The NFL released a statement shortly after the Monday night football game was postponed:
“Tonight’s Buffalo Bills-Cincinnati Bengals game has been postponed after Buffalo Bills’ Damar Hamlin collapsed, NFL Commissioner Roger Goodell announced. Hamlin received immediate medical attention on the field by team and independent medical staff and local paramedics. He was then transported to a local hospital where he is in critical condition. Our thoughts are with Damar and the Buffalo Bills. We will provide more information as it becomes available. The NFL has been in constant communication with the NFL Players Association which is in agreement with postponing the game.”
An update from the Buffalo Bills shared early this morning revealed that “Damar Hamlin suffered a cardiac arrest following a hit in our game versus the Bengals. His heartbeat was restored on the field and he was transferred to the UC Medical Center for further testing and treatment. He is currently sedated and listed in critical condition.”
